    750 V Automotive Qualified Bare Die Silicon Carbide MOSFETs – Gen 3+

    Wolfspeed's automotive qualified Gen 3+ family of 750 V silicon carbide MOSFETs are optimized for high power applications
    Wolfspeed continues to lead in silicon carbide (SiC) with the Automotive 750 V E-Series Bare Die SiC MOSFET. The product is fully automotive qualified, with high blocking voltage with the industry-leading low RDS(ON) over temperature stability, enabling low conduction losses and highest figures of merit in the most demanding applications. This device is optimized for use in high power applications such as automotive drive trains, motor drives, solid state circuit breakers, and more. The 750 V MOSFET is designed for low RDS(ON), are easy to parallel and compatible with standard gate drive design. The efficiency gained by moving from a silicon-based solution to Silicon Carbide can help reduce system size, weight, and cooling requirements.

    Features

    • Automotive Qualified
    • High blocking voltage with industry leading low RDS(on) over temperature stability
    • Resistant to latch-up
    • High gate resistance for drives

    Benefits

    • Improves System Efficiency with lower switching and conduction losses
    • Reduces System Size, Weight, and Cooling Requirements
    • Enables high switching frequency operation
    • Easy to parallel and compatible with standard gate drive design

    Typical Applications

    • Automotive Drivetrain
    • Motor Drives
    • Solid State Circuit Breaker
